What Are Cataracts and Exactly How Do They Establish?



Cataracts are an usual eye condition that generally establishes slowly over time. They take place when the proteins in the lens of your eye begin to clump with each other, triggering the lens to become cloudy. This cloudiness can make it tough to see plainly and can even lead to vision loss if left untreated.

While age is a major threat element for creating cataracts, various other aspects such as genes, cigarette smoking, and certain medical problems can additionally increase your chances.

Comprehending exactly how cataracts establish is the first step in understanding why cataract eye surgery might be required.

Types of Cataract Surgery



Types of cataract surgery can differ depending on the extent of the condition and specific needs. One of the most usual type is phacoemulsification, which uses ultrasound power to break up the over cast lens and remove it with a small cut.

Extracapsular cataract extraction is one more option, involving a larger laceration to get rid of the gloomy lens unscathed.
